Visitors come for the resorts and restaurants, majestic mountains, desert flora, and scenic golf courses while its numerous festivals make them want to stay.

Tastes & Sounds of Cathedral City a weekly music and food event at the Cathedral City Community Amphitheater.
The SPRING 2026 EDITION of Tastes & Sounds of Cathedral City is set for February 10th through April 7th, 2026, featuring LIVE music and food in the Cathedral City Community Amphitheater. The event is free to attend.

Join us for the 10th Annual Cathedral City LGBT+ Days presented by Agua Caliente Casinos - March 3rd through 8th... Cat City Drag Race, Rally and Flag Raising, Festival with Headliner David Archuleta, Bed Races and Vendor Marketplace, VIP options and more!
